  • Description
    KKFFVLK polypeptide is a peptide amphiphile (PA). This polypeptide contains a hexadecyl lipid chain and a peptide sequence with two phenylalanine (FF) residues at the C-terminus. The FF residues drive self-assembly through hydrophobic and π-stacking interactions. It is designed based on the KLVFF core motif from the amyloid beta (Aβ) peptide. The serine protease α-chymotrypsin can cleave KKFFVLK at two sites, leading to products KKF with FVLK and KKFF with VLK. KKFFVLK forms nanotubes and helical ribbons at room temperature, which is associated with its substantial β-sheet secondary structure. This nanostructure causes light scattering and a partly cloudy appearance in solution. The ability of KKFFVLK to form specific nanostructures and its responsiveness to enzymatic cleavage make it an interesting candidate for applications such as enzyme-responsive delivery systems or in the study of self-assembly processes related to biomaterials and nanotechnology.

  • About TFA salt

    Trifluoroacetic acid (TFA) is a common counterion from the purification process using High-Performance Liquid Chromatography (HPLC). The presence of TFA can affect the peptide's net weight, appearance, and solubility.

    Impact on Net Weight: The TFA salt contributes to the total mass of the product. In most cases, the peptide content constitutes >80% of the total weight, with TFA accounting for the remainder.

    Solubility: TFA salts generally enhance the solubility of peptides in aqueous solutions.

    In Biological Assays: For most standard in vitro assays, the residual TFA levels do not cause interference. However, for highly sensitive cellular or biochemical studies, please be aware of its presence.
